In School — Before residency
The period before residency starts when you make voluntary payments while still enrolled. Interest accrues on principal only (deferment rules). Payments clear pre-existing accrued interest first, then new accrued interest, then principal.
In Residency — Repayment
Residency start = capitalization date. All unpaid accrued interest merges into principal. Interest then accrues on the full capitalized balance each month.
